When I was in high school, my family decided to go on a vacation to Disney World, and with any trip like that, you think the draw would be the castle or the rides. Not around here, partner; there is this lovely little place called Epcot where you can see firsthand a little snapshot of cultures around the world. I remember my grandpa going into this little bakery in the Norway Pavilion, and to my utter disbelief, this small man came out of this hole-in-the-wall shop with 15 orders of school bread. To this day, I do not know how he didn't drop a single one. He passed them out to all his grandchildren, sneaked a couple into his bag, and we went about our merry way.

Would you agree that the accomplishments and sorrows of owning a business cannot be replicated in any other environment? I would argue that every business leader, including myself, has experienced exquisite highs and devastating lows during the lifetime of their company—and quite often, we do it alone. Confessing a financial loss may irrevocably interrupt the trust you’ve built with customers; celebrating a huge sales win may trigger feelings of unmerited entitlement in employees. Where can an entrepreneur go to truly share the burden and the joy of owning a business?
